Output 8d539220c78eff33fc7acb92b70ce939396f7b5b6c672fe34c426146d2bc6e14:2

value
8836248
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 32a8105d3ce74998bc628d53a42f6d2acdcbe011bf64c46767f9620339dd22c9
address
bc1px25pqhfuuaye30rz34f6gtmd9txuhcq3hajvgem8l93qxwwaytys7a7krm
transaction
8d539220c78eff33fc7acb92b70ce939396f7b5b6c672fe34c426146d2bc6e14
spent
true